Active Directory actions reference - Power Automate
WebParent path: Enter the LDAP URL that identifies the server that hosts the Active Directory services. For example, LDAP://192.168.2.60/DC=corporate,DC=com Build parent path: Create the LDAP URL: Click the Build parent path option to connect to the Active Directory server. WebActive Directory actions. Active Directory actions require a connection to an Active Directory server. Establish the connection using the Connect to server action and an LDAP path. … horn subwoofer box

Web23 Aug 2012 · The object returned from Get-ADUser doesn't have a parent property, nor does the underlying AD object itself. However the .NET type System.DirectoryServices.DirectoryEntry does, and instances can be created with the DN of an object.. But first: … horns up hand sign
